As digital threats continue to evolve, organizations are increasingly turning to artificial intelligence (AI) to bolster their network security measures. The landscape of cybersecurity is rapidly transforming, with AI playing a central role in creating proactive defense strategies.
In recent years, the rise of AI technologies has been felt across various industries. In the realm of IT and cybersecurity, AI has proven to be a game-changer. Traditional network security measures, often reactive and manual in nature, are increasingly being supplemented or replaced by AI-driven solutions that can analyze vast amounts of data at lightning speed.
AI-powered security solutions leverage machine learning algorithms to identify patterns and anomalies in network behavior. This capability allows for real-time threat detection and response, significantly reducing the response time to security incidents. Moreover, AI can automate repetitive tasks, enabling IT security teams to focus on more strategic initiatives.
While the benefits of AI in network security are compelling, there are challenges to consider. The reliance on AI can introduce new vulnerabilities, and adversaries are also using AI to develop sophisticated attacks. Furthermore, implementing AI solutions requires substantial investment in technology and training.
